Transaction 63b5cf9693acfcdd03b526812902a404d79ea6bb944182c34caed8a0222b6d47
1 Input
1 Output
-
63b5cf9693acfcdd03b526812902a404d79ea6bb944182c34caed8a0222b6d47:0
- value
- 37327694
- script pubkey
- OP_0 OP_PUSHBYTES_20 aafff53f920c7a021c941abc358e4bb81ca60649
- address
- bc1q4tll20ujp3aqy8y5r27rtrjthqw2vpjfxdm8u9